Problem
Off-road and all-terrain vehicles' windshields become obstructed by debris in dirty, muddy, or sandy terrain, impeding visibility and requiring removal or folding, which leaves passengers vulnerable and necessitates cleaning.
Innovation Solution
A transparent plastic film roll is attached to metal tubes secured to the windshield, with a mechanical and electrical component that allows the film to rotate, clearing obstructed areas by moving debris into the tubes and replacing it with clear film.

A windshield vision cover and devise to operate the cover. The windshield cover is a transparent plastic film that protects a visible area of the windshield of a vehicle. The devise is a pair of metal tubes that house the plastic film, a mechanical component, and an electrical component. The electrical component sends power to the mechanical component, causing the spool within the tubes to rotate. This moves the plastic film between the tubes, replacing the plastic film covering the visible area of the windshield. This invention allows off-road vehicles to effortlessly maintain visibility without the need for operators to remove a windshield, purchase foldable windshields, purchase disposable windshields, or subject the internal area of the vehicle to debris.
